If i buy a cable box for a second TV, will it work with comcast cable?
-
I already have comcast cable service coming into my home, and wanted to know if I were to buy a cable box for my second tv would it work?
-
Answer:
You cannot go out and buy a cable box, or at least just any. You need one that will work with your provider, or is 3rd party a Cablecard box. You may need to buy one from the cable provider or an authorized agent, of which for most cable providers they only lease them. Stay away from "used" ones on Ebay, Craigslist, or the like, at least without consulting with your provider first, to make sure they will allow such and the box you wish to buy can be activated on their system.
